The LTC1407HMSE#PBF is a high-performance, dual-channel 14-bit, 3Msps analog-to-digital converter (ADC) from Linear Technology, designed to bring precision and speed to a wide range of applications that require accurate and fast data acquisition. Its compact form factor and low power consumption make it an excellent choice for portable and space-constrained applications.
Key Features
- Resolution: The LTC1407HMSE#PBF boasts a 14-bit resolution, ensuring high precision in the digital representation of analog signals.
- Sampling Rate: With a sampling rate of up to 3Msps (mega samples per second), this ADC can accurately capture high-speed signals.
- Dual Channel: It features two simultaneously sampling channels, allowing for the processing of two analog inputs at the same time, which is ideal for complex systems that require multi-channel monitoring.
- Low Power: Designed with power efficiency in mind, it operates with a low power consumption, making it suitable for battery-operated devices.
- Easy Interface: The product offers a serial interface, which simplifies connections to microcontrollers or digital signal processors (DSPs).
- Multiple Conversion Results: It can provide two's complement or straight binary results, offering flexibility in data handling.
